Re: ECD topic

?Isn't this something that sekerob already does?

Mention him ECD & make sure you got helmet ON! biggrin

Don't get me wrong...he's doing a great job for WCG...but his charts only gives total amount of FINISHED job, not in any way future estimates!
The idea is to make a topic about ECD (even though only 1 exists & it's Sgt.Joe's about MCM)...so you can plan in months:
- so have 9m to ECD, but can get another step of Diamond badge in 7m time...so I can run that project exclusively for next 7m!
- the project ends in 1y, but I need 18m to finish it...so either I invest in more cores to get to next step or switch to other projects here on WCG!

I'd be great if WCG decided to put ECD on ALL projects...but their policy is 6m in advance...& sometimes when you hunt 20y, 50y, 100y or 200y Diamond badge - you need a prolonged estimate than 6m!

Re: ECD topic

The used percentages come directly from the Research page, where an End month will show if WCG anticipates (by working of their algorithm) if 6 months or less are left. They will NOT publish anything longer out, with too many variables going into the equation [Help has an FAQ for this topic, for those who wish to read up, plus jhindo I think made 1 or more posts expanding on the matter. Search and thou shalleth find]
